Medical Massage Therapy Program Coordinator

Primary Location: 4800 Preston Park Boulevard, Plano, Texas, 75093

Provide program coordination and management for the Medical Massage Therapy program, including staffing, facility and resource/equipment management and inventory control, program promotion, accreditation preparation and compliance, curriculum development and revision, course instruction, instructor evaluation, clinical site management, student and application management, and compliance with state regulations.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Supervision, management, and administration of the day-to-day activities of the program.
  • Align the program with accreditation standards and state compliance regulations; work closely with accrediting body and state licensing agency.
  • Teach assigned classes if needed, with sufficient non-instructional time to effectively fulfill administrative and compliance duties.
  • Curriculum design, curriculum assessment, instructional supervision, and instructional evaluation.
  • Maintain current awareness of the field through professional development specific to the program. Participate in service to the college.
  • Responsible for budget development and management; maintenance of adequate resources and institutional support for the program. Participate in the financial planning and management of the program to ensure net revenue goals are met or exceeded.
  • Serve as the primary contact for students, instructors, and staff.
  • Recruit, interview, and recommend the hiring of part-time instructors and staff for the program.
  • Promote the program through internal and external sources and through social media using college approved artwork.
  • Assist with managing the student admission, advisement, progression, completion, certification and licensing process for the program. Assist in facilitating and resolving student complaints/concerns in a constructive, fair, and balanced manner, following the college's core values while working with instructors, students, and college staff.
